Given vectors A = ax + 3az and B = 5ax + 2ay – 6az, the value of |A + B| will be
  1. 6
  2. 7
  3. 25
  4. 49

Correct answer: B

Explanation

Adding components gives A+B=(1+5)ax+2a_y+(3−6)az=6a_x+2a_y−3a_z. Its magnitude is √(6²+2²+3²)=√49=7, which corresponds to option B.

Exam Takeaway

Add vector components first, then take the Euclidean magnitude.

Common Mistake

Do not add vector magnitudes directly unless the vectors are collinear in the same direction.
